Sometimes, we get stuck in a rut and it’s hard to get out. Doesn’t matter if you want to improve your professional or personal life, it’s all just life.
Here are 5 ways you can improve the quality of your life today.
Stop Thinking
Sounds crazy, right? It’s not.
Don’t stop thinking completely. You still need to use your knowledge and experience. That’s okay.
But, when you sacrifice action for thought, that’s not okay. In other words, do more, think less.
“I think I should start eating healthier.”
“I think I should work out so I can lose weight.”
“I think I need to write more.”
You can’t make significant changes simply by thinking about things. You need to take action. Stop thinking about eating healthier and eat healthier.
Stop thinking about how your life would be better if you wrote more and start typing now.
Stop thinking about the perfect solution and start taking action. In most cases, there is no such thing as a perfect solution. You can improve and make better decisions as you move forward. But, you must get started first.
Get New Friends
If you have a group of positive, successful friends right now, you’re probably doing very well in life.
However, if your closest friends constantly criticize others, are lazy, have no ambition, or are simply not interested in growing, it may be time to look for a new group of friends.
As Jim Rohn once said, you are the average of the five people you spend the most time with. If your five closest friends are unemployed, it’s highly unlikely that you will rise to become CEO of a fortune 500 company.
The people you choose to spend time with will have a major influence on how you live your life. Find people that are living the type of life you want to live and get to know them better.
Find people that will help you grow and get rid of those that make you feel small or hold you back.
Give More
Most people think you must take what you want in life in order to be successful. While it’s important to be proactive and take action, a major factor in success is actually giving.
Some people call it Karma, some call it generosity. Whatever you call it, giving strategically, without expectations, will help improve the quality of your life.
When you give, it makes you feel good about yourself, and it makes the recipient feel better about you too. Giving can help you build deeper, more satisfying relationships with friends, family, co-workers, business associates or even strangers.
There are numerous ways to give more. You can volunteer. You can say thank you. You can introduce people. You can give positive feedback. You can give free services. There is no limit to the number of ways you can help others through giving.
Give and you will receive.
Focus on You
People spend a lot of time thinking and worrying about things that they cannot control. Don’t be one of those people.
It can be a challenge, but if you focus on the things you can control, you will be a million times happier.
For example, you cannot change the past. Stop wasting energy reliving bad experiences from the past. You can certainly learn from your experiences, but holding on too tight is an exercise in futility.
Instead, focus on the things you can control – your actions.
If you want to be a professional singer, focus on practicing. Write music. Take voice lessons. Communicate with people in the industry. Those are things you can control.
You can’t control whether people like your music or not. You can’t control whether you win a singing contest. You can control your own actions and the steps you take every single day to get where you want to go. Constantly grow, improve, learn, practice, and focus on the things you can control.
Learn from the outcomes, consequences, and reactions, but focus on becoming the best “you” you can be.
Practice Mind Control
We are bombarded with negative information and thoughts every day.
The “news” is one negative story after another. People love to criticize others instead of improving their own lives.
It’s easy to fall into the trap of negative thinking.
“I can’t do this.”
“I’m not good at that.”
“It would be too difficult.”
Before you know it, you have a permanent attitude problem.
To change that, you need to control the thoughts in your head. We spend a lot of time trying to maintain a healthy body, but most people spend zero time trying to maintain a healthy mind.
Think of all the things you have to be grateful for. Life itself is a gift and there are numerous ways to enjoy it. If you can walk, talk, see, read, breathe and think, you have the power to do almost anything.
Control the thoughts in your mind by maintaining a gratitude journal, reading positive stories, books, or articles. Protect your mind from negative influences. Stay away from those people who thrive on constant gossip, criticism, and negativity.
If you keep a constant flow of positive, inspiring thoughts going into your head, those thoughts will guide you as you become a better person.
